It's official: QNX® technology has shipped in the infotainment and telematics systems of over 50 million vehicles. More impressive still, IHS has named QNX the clear leader in car infotainment, with over 50% market share. Read the press release.
What do the 2015 Golf, Golf GTI, Passat, Polo, and Touareg have in common? Simple: they all ship with QNX-powered infotainment systems. The systems include the Touareg's RNS 850 navigation unit, which offers Google Street View and 3D Google Earth maps. Read the press release and the blog post.
For more than a decade, QNX and LG have collaborated on successful, large-volume telematics programs. Enter a new initiative in which LG will use QNX technology to build infotainment systems, instrument clusters, and ADAS solutions for the global car market. Read the press release.
